Most people would agree with the psalmist when he says in Psalm 53:1, “The fool says in his heart, ‘There is no God.’ They are corrupt and their ways are vile.” 

But would they agree with the last phrase of verse 1? “There is no one who does good?” Not just, there are many who don’t do good. It says here, there is no one who does good.
 
If you’re not sure you agree with this, listen to verse 2, “God looks down on the sons of man to see if there are any who understand, any who seek God.” What do you think God finds? Does anyone understand Him? Does anyone seek after Him? For the answer read verse 3, “Everyone has turned away, they have together become corrupt. There is no one who does good, not even one.” What a devastating indictment.
 
What this basically says is what Paul declares in Romans 3:23, “All have sinned and come short of the glory of God.” In fact, in the early part of Romans 3 Paul quotes from this very Psalm to make his argument that all have sinned and come short of God’s glory. It’s not just the fool who says there is no God, who is sinful, wicked and separated from God. All of us are in desperate need because we are sinners, separated from God. 
 
We need a Savior. Jesus is God’s only provision for that desperate need we all have. He is the one and only mediator between God and us. Let me encourage you to turn to Him and trust in Him with all your heart right now.
 
Paul declared in Romans 6:23, “The wages of sin is death, but the gift of God is eternal life in Christ Jesus our Lord.”
